Ticket: Signature check failed on the Marrowbeck encoding-detector plugin (v2.3). The verifier rejected the bundle because the manifest was re-saved as UTF-16 after signing, which altered the byte stream. Plugin authors: ensure your manifest and detection tables remain UTF-8 without BOM, sign last, and never open signed archives in editors that transcode. We have re-issued the publishing credentials for affected authors. Re-sign your bundle with the key provided immediately below this note.

rollout seal: bky4_x7Gc

**Ticket QV-2281: Bloom filter false negatives in Quillvault cache layer**

Repro: seed Quillvault with 10k keys, restart the filter service mid-write, then query any key written during restart. Lookups bypass the KV store and return empty. Suspect the filter snapshot isn't flushed on shutdown. To reproduce against staging, authenticate with the bearer token below.

session JWT of yawep-yawep = eyJhbGciOiJIUzI1NiIsInR5cCI6IkpXVCJ9.eyJzdWIiOiI3pWF3_In0.aXYsHiog

Release checklist — Feedwright podcast validator, step 7: confirm the RSS conformance suite passes against both the legacy and strict parsers, and that the changelog notes the new enclosure-size check. Reviewer signs off only after diffing validator output on the Larkmoor sample feeds. Record your approval next to the build token below.

pipeline stamp: htk4_ae36

Ticket #TQ-114 — Thumbnail queue vault locked

Scope: Pixelgrove thumbnail generation queue halted. The signing vault that authorizes worker nodes locked after a credential rotation misfire. Queue depth climbing; no data loss, but new uploads render without previews. Security review needed before unseal: confirm rotation logs show no external access attempts, verify worker allowlist unchanged, and sign off on the manual override. Once reviewed, restart workers in batches of five and watch error rates. Unseal with the recovery passphrase below.

vault phrase of bagaf-kajeg = jorath-feniel-briir-siliel-ralix